Control chart is one of the most commonly used tools in quality control.The Pivot statistic was proposed by A.R.Soltani in 2019 and it has been proved that under certain conditions,the limit distribution of the Pivot statistic is the standard normal distribution.The purpose of this thesis is to use Pivot statistics and Bootstrap method to construct a control chart that is suitable for many kinds of distributions and can monitor all parameters of the population at once.This thesis first introduces the method of constructing control a Pivot control chart.This paper calculated the average run length(ARL)of the Pivot control chart.For Weibull distribution,it is found that the!of the Pivot control chart is the closest to the theoretical value,but"-charts are not.When only the scale parameters are shifted,the Pivot control chart performs better than Bootstrap Percentile control chart.But the Pivot control chart is not suitable for monitoring the situation where only the shape parameter shifts.When the shape parameter and the scale parameter are shifted at the same time,the Pivot control chart performs better than the Bootstrap quantile control chart.For Logistic distribution,the APL0 of the Pivot control chart is close to the theoretical value.Although the Bootstrap quantile control chart is better than the Pivot control chart when only the scale parameter is shifted or only the position parameter is shifted,the Pivot control chart is better than the Bootstrap quantile control chart when the scale parameter and the position parameter are shifted at the same time.Finally,this thesis applies the Pivot control chart to the real data that obey the Weibull distribution and the Logistic distribution respectively.The Pivot control chart successfully monitored the process changes,but the"-chart and the Bootstrap quantile control chart were not monitored,indicating that the Pivot control chart is more effective.
